发明名称 MICROELECTROMECHANICAL GYROSCOPE WITH OPEN LOOP READING DEVICE AND CONTROL METHOD
摘要 A microelectromechanical gyroscope that includes a first mass oscillatable according to a first axis; an inertial sensor, including a second mass, drawn along by the first mass and constrained so as to oscillate according to a second axis, in response to a rotation of the gyroscope; a driving device coupled to the first mass so as to form a feedback control loop and configured to maintain the first mass in oscillation at a resonance frequency; and an open-loop reading device coupled to the inertial sensor for detecting displacements of the second mass according to the second axis. The driving device includes a read signal generator for supplying to the inertial sensor at least one read signal having the form of a square-wave signal of amplitude that sinusoidally varies with the resonance frequency.

主权项 1. A device, comprising: a first mass; a second mass coupled to the first mass to oscillate in response to the first mass; a driving circuit coupled to the first mass to form a feedback control loop and to maintain the first mass in oscillation at a resonance frequency; a reading circuit coupled to the second mass to detect displacements of the second mass; and a read signal generator structured to supply to the second mass at least one read signal that varies with the resonance frequency.
